Tomorrow’s my class – I’m looking forward to it! 2 weeks ago 7 of my 10 class members didn’t knit – as of last week EVERYONE was ribbing, some we cabling and everyone else was doing twisted stitches. This week we’re going to tackle cables for EVERYONE and then regress to garter stitch (I teach weird, I don’t get to garter stitch until I know my students know which way their stitches are “facing” when their on the needle)

I also want to start a little colorwork for them – that could be fun, too! It’s a sensational class – really great students – I can’t wait to see what they come up with for their projects!
